Output 58c520f6bad7a3e7eced8e9400d09b2bdcc7a42f541f1b3df1196be00cab9da3:1

value
2903529
script pubkey
OP_0 OP_PUSHBYTES_20 00f89baad94bbbfa7afbbe0cd559ec30f30467ed
address
ltc1qqrufh2kefwal57hmhcxd2k0vxresgeld4lsmhv
transaction
58c520f6bad7a3e7eced8e9400d09b2bdcc7a42f541f1b3df1196be00cab9da3
spent
true